I think I've read you can get refills on drinks of Coke and tea at TS restaurants, but can you also get refills of milk? I have 2 boys (age 12) who are big milk drinkers.

Also, with the refillable mugs, I'm pretty sure I read you can't get milk or juice, but are there other drinks that are not soft drinks, coffee or tea? Maybe lemonade? What about hot chocolate?
 
I'm not sure about the milk refills. My kids usually just drink one glass. With the refillable mugs, you can't get milk or juice. You can get tea, there is sometimes lemonade or fruit punch in the machines. There is hot chocolate.
 
They do have a Powerade at the drink machine. I believe it's the blue kind..I'm not too sure on the flavor though.

Usually every refill of milk is another charge.
 


No milk or juice refills at TS.

The refillable mugs can be used only at the resorts, not the parks, generally for coffee, tea, hot chocolate, iced tea, soda, and Hi-C type drinks, but again specifically no milk or juice.
 
No milk or juice refills at TS.

1) Usually correct.
2) Remember,
. . . WDW pays zero for the fountain syrup for soda (Coke products), so refills are cheap to do. *
. . . Milk is costly, so they don't want to "give-it-away".

* This is the deal that got Pepsi thrown out of Disney parks. At one time both Coke and Pepsi products were sold at Disney; at an annual contract re-bid process, Coke offered FREE fountain syrup. So much for Pepsi.

If a child were to get a milk for their first beverage could they select a different beverage like sprite or lemonade for their refill if there isn't a free refill on milk?
 
For my kids, when they were under 10, I never got charged for milk refills. Never tried for anyone ordering an adult meal.
 
We've seen both sides at TS restaurants. We've asked for re-fills on apple juice and got them for no charge. We've also asked and have been told that it is an extra charge. I guess it depends on the restaurant and waiter/waitress, but I would plan on any non-machine dispensing drink to be an extra cost to re-fill.
